Chris McQueen is a 24-year-old football player who plays as a center back for Edinburgh City, born on February 20, 2002. Follow Chris McQueen on FotMob for live match updates, detailed statistics, career history, transfer news, FotMob ratings, and comprehensive performance analytics.
In the 2025/2026 League Two season, Chris McQueen has recorded 0 goals, 0 assists, 765 minutes, 2 yellow cards.
Chris McQueen scores highly on Minutes compared to center backs in the League Two.
Chris McQueen's 9 most recent matches are shown below. Visit each match page for full details including lineups, match events, and advanced statistics:
- March 21, 2026: 0-3 loss at home vs Elgin City (90 minutes, 1 yellow card)
- March 14, 2026: 0-3 loss away at Annan Athletic (90 minutes)
- March 7, 2026: 4-1 win at home vs Stranraer (90 minutes)
- February 28, 2026: 0-0 draw at home vs Forfar Athletic (90 minutes)
- February 24, 2026: 0-3 loss away at Elgin City (46 minutes)
- February 21, 2026: 0-5 loss away at Clyde (90 minutes)
- February 14, 2026: 0-0 draw away at Spartans FC (90 minutes)
- February 7, 2026: 0-2 loss at home vs East Kilbride (90 minutes, 1 yellow card)
- January 31, 2026: 2-1 win away at Dumbarton (90 minutes)
Chris McQueen's next match is on April 18, 2026 when Edinburgh City face East Kilbride in the League Two.
